What type of PR is this?
/kind failing-test
What this PR does / why we need it: The test is severely flaky due to test-environment factors. While we have merged a mitigation, the issue seems to persist. We recommend disabling the test temporarily and figuring out a way to resolve the root cause of the flakiness after.
Which issue(s) this PR fixes:
Related to #96710 (do not close the issue until the true root cause for the flake is fixed)
